Abstract: Agrarian reform is aimed to reform the structure of land authority to increase farmer income and be the basic of economic development implementation leading to fair and prosperous community regarding to Pancasila. The management of fair, sustainable, and environmental friendly agrarian and natural resources should be implemented in Indonesia with good coordination, integration, and accommodation of dynamic, aspiration, and role of community. In its utilization, agrarian reform object land utilization can be implemented through increasing the people’s ability in order to increase the productivity which is fair socially, economically, and environmentally on it. Moreover, empowering villages to be able to manage ownership, authority, use, and utilization of land, forest, and natural resources in their areas together will be required. Community empowerment in access reform activity is to create or increase the capacity of community, both individually and in group, in solving any problems after the implementation of land redistribution or asset form in increasing life quality, independence, and prosperity.
